Timeline & Setting – The Mother (2023)
Explore the full timeline and setting of The Mother (2023). Follow every major event in chronological order and see how the environment shapes the story, characters, and dramatic tension.

Time period

The narrative spans over several years, capturing the transition from the Mother’s tumultuous past as a military operative to her struggle for motherhood in modern times. The film highlights themes of trauma and resilience across multiple timelines, exploring the impact of previous military engagements on personal life and family.

Location

Alaska, Cuba, Guantanamo Bay

The movie takes key scenes in Alaska, where the Mother retreats to a secluded cabin for years, emphasizing isolation and introspection. Cuba is portrayed as a tropical backdrop, central to the Mother’s quest to confront her past. Guantanamo Bay is significant as it marks the beginning of her dark partnership in arms dealing and child trafficking.

Main Characters – The Mother (2023)
Meet the key characters of The Mother (2023), with detailed profiles, motivations, and roles in the plot. Understand their emotional journeys and what they reveal about the film’s deeper themes.

The Mother (Jennifer Lopez)

The Mother is a complex character defined by her fierce determination and deep love for her daughter, Zoe. A former military operative, her world is marked by violence and tragedy, yet she embodies resilience as she fights against her past to ensure Zoe's safety. Her transformation from a soldier to a protector showcases her strength in the face of adversity.

👩‍👧 Mother 💪 Strength 🌪️ Resilience

Adrian Lovell (Joseph Fiennes)

Adrian Lovell is a charismatic yet dangerous character, exuding an enigmatic charm that masks his ruthless nature. His past connection with the Mother complicates their relationship, as it blends both love and treachery among arms dealing and trafficking. His cunning nature poses a significant threat, especially concerning Zoe's safety.

⚔️ Villain 🕵️‍♂️ Manipulator ❤️ Complex

Hector Álvarez (Gael García Bernal)

Hector Álvarez serves as a formidable arms dealer with deep ties to the dark underworld of child trafficking. His ruthlessness is countered by a calculated mind, making him both dangerous and cunning. As a key antagonist, his pursuit of power drives the plot, affecting all characters involved.

💰 Arms Dealer 🎭 Cunning 🚨 Threat

William Cruise (Omari Hardwick)

FBI Special Agent William Cruise is the embodiment of dedication and duty, providing a moral compass amidst the chaos. He assists the Mother while facing the brutal realities of their dangerous missions. His protective nature towards Zoe and the Mother adds depth to his character, portraying him as a staunch ally in their quest for safety.

🕵️‍♂️ Agent 🤝 Ally 🛡️ Protector

Zoe (Lucy Paez)

Zoe represents innocence and resilience, embodying a young girl caught in a tumultuous world. Her journey from foster care to confronting danger showcases her growth and bravery. Her relationship with the Mother evolves throughout the film, reflecting themes of loyalty and courage.

Major Themes – The Mother (2023)
Explore the central themes of The Mother (2023), from psychological, social, and emotional dimensions to philosophical messages. Understand what the film is really saying beneath the surface.

👩‍👧 Motherhood

The theme of motherhood is central to the story, exploring the lengths a mother will go to protect her child. The Mother's fierce instincts and sacrifices illustrate a maternal bond overshadowed by violence and danger. This theme resonates deeply as she navigates her dangerous past to secure a future for her daughter.

🔫 Violence

Violence pervades the narrative, detailing both the physical and emotional battles the characters endure. The Mother's past as a military operative is laden with bloodshed, and her confrontations with adversaries highlight the brutal reality of her world. This theme reveals the complex relationship between survival and morality, shaping their lives.

🔍 Trauma and Redemption

The themes of trauma and redemption are intricately woven throughout the story. The Mother's haunting past leads to a search for redemption as she attempts to right the wrongs inflicted upon her and her daughter. Each encounter serves as a step towards healing, showcasing the impact of past choices on present circumstances.
